# 如何实现Android可视化调试工具
在现代Android开发中,调试工具是实现高效开发和测试的重要手段。本文将指导你如何实现一个简单的Android可视化调试工具,包括具体工作流程及每一步的实现代码。
## 1. 项目流程概述
首先,我们将整个开发过程分为以下几步,以表格的形式展示:
| 步骤 | 描述 |
|
# Android调试工具可视化
在Android开发过程中,调试是一个非常重要的环节。通过调试工具可以帮助开发者查找和修复程序中的bug,提高开发效率。本文将介绍一种在Android开发中常用的调试工具——可视化调试工具,并提供代码示例和图示帮助读者更好地理解。
## 可视化调试工具是什么?
可视化调试工具是指通过图形化界面展示程序运行状态、变量值、函数调用等信息,帮助开发者更直观地了解程
原创
2024-03-05 07:05:35
82阅读
1. 查看当前堆栈1) 功能:在程序中加入代码,使可以在logcat中看到打印出的当前函数调用关系2) 方法: new Exception(“print trace”).printStackTrace();
2. MethodTracing
1) 功能:用于热点分析和性能优化,分析每个函数占用的CPU时间,调用次数,函数调用关系等
2) 方法:
a) 在程序代码中加入追踪开关
1. import
一、效果图二、重要方法和函数①模块和头文件:Qt中要调试串口,需要在.pro文件中增加串口调试的模块,代码如下:QT += serialport然后在头文件中,需要包含串口调试的头文件,代码如下所示:#include <QSerialPort>
#include <QSerialPortInfo>②获取可用串口:Qt下获取可用串口非常简单,QSerialPortInfo类有
今天小编总结归纳了若干个常用的可视化图表,并且通过调用plotly、matplotlib、altair、bokeh和seaborn等模块来分别绘制这些常用的可视化图表,最后无论是绘制可视化的代码,还是会指出来的结果都会通过调用streamlit模块展示在一个可视化大屏,出来的效果如下图所示那我们接下去便一步一步开始可视化大屏的制作吧!标题、副标题以及下拉框首先我们对标题、副标题部分的内容,代码如下
转载
2024-01-02 12:45:57
97阅读
https://www.3gmfw.cn/soft/html2/2015/06/15807.html
转载
2023-09-05 17:11:29
233阅读
# 数据可视化串口调试助手
在嵌入式系统开发中,串口通信是常见的一种方式。然而,在调试过程中,我们经常需要通过串口进行数据的传输和调试信息的输出。而传统的串口调试工具通常只能以文本形式呈现数据,这样很难直观地观察数据的变化。因此,我们需要一个数据可视化串口调试助手,能够将串口接收的数据以图形化的方式呈现出来,更方便我们进行调试和分析。
## 功能需求
我们的数据可视化串口调试助手需要具备以下
原创
2024-06-28 05:35:51
237阅读
根据介绍,Manifold 将帮助工程师和科学家识别机器学习数据切片和模型性能问题,并通过显示数据子集之间的特征分布差异来诊断问题的根本原因。在 Uber,Manifold 已经成为机器学习平台 Michelangelo 的一部分,并帮助 Uber 的各个产品团队分析和调试机器学习模型的性能。自从去年早些时候 在 Uber Eng Blog 上重点介绍这个项目以来,Uber 已经收到了很多来自社区
原创
2021-03-29 17:48:30
625阅读
零、获取方式本框架已上架Cocos Store,请打开store.cocos.com并搜索kylins即可点击文末阅读原文即可跳转到对应页面一、客官,请留步上面的丑
原创
2021-12-14 10:59:33
224阅读
零、获取方式本框架已上架Cocos Store,请打开store.cocos.com并搜索kylins即可点击文末阅读即可跳转到对应页面一、客官,请留步上面的丑图,各位可能看不出来是干嘛的,不过不担心。阅读完本文后,保证解除你所有疑惑。
原创
2022-01-16 17:00:05
562阅读
转载地址:https://www.cnblogs.com/qvchuang/p/adb.html
转载
2021-03-13 10:21:48
2630阅读
初衷 首先adb这里就不多做介绍了,因为工作中经常会用到adb(譬如:安装、卸载、截图、查包名、打日志等常用功能) 为了提高工作效率,同时避免重复输入adb命令,就准备写一个工具,把常用的一些adb命令封装在一起方便使用 刚开始就是一个简单的cmd黑窗口形式,由于界面太丑实在没有食欲,就又用pyqt ...
转载
2020-06-30 15:29:00
1113阅读
3评论
## 实现 JavaScript 的串口调试工具
### 简介
在开发过程中,我们经常需要与硬件设备进行通信,其中串口通信是一种常见的方式。为了方便调试和测试,我们可以使用 JavaScript 的串口调试工具来模拟串口通信。本文将详细介绍如何实现这个功能,并提供代码示例。
### 整体流程
下面是实现 JavaScript 的串口调试工具的整体流程,我们可以使用一个表格来展示每个步骤和需要的
原创
2023-10-07 10:53:06
506阅读
Linux 串口调试工具是一种非常重要的工具,它可以帮助开发人员在Linux操作系统上进行串口通信的调试工作。在嵌入式和物联网等领域中,串口通信被广泛应用于设备与设备之间的数据传输。因此,Linux 串口调试工具的作用不可忽视。
首先,我们来介绍一下串口通信。串口通信是一种逐位传输的通信方式,通过串行接口,将数据一个接一个地发送或接收。在嵌入式系统中,串口通信被广泛应用于与外设的通信,例如通过串
原创
2024-02-04 12:46:28
622阅读
# Android 串口调试工具实现指南
## 介绍
在Android开发中,串口调试工具是一个常见的需求,它可以用于与外部硬件设备进行通信。本文将教你如何实现一个Android串口调试工具。
## 流程概览
下面是整个实现过程的流程图:
```mermaid
gantt
title Android 串口调试工具实现流程
section 初始化
安装串口驱动: do
原创
2024-01-24 04:03:08
352阅读
1评论
# 串口调试工具在Android开发中的应用
在Android开发中,串口通信(UART)常用于与外部设备的交互,例如传感器、Arduino、蓝牙模块等。为了方便开发调试,串口调试工具应运而生。本篇文章将介绍串口调试工具的基本概念,以及如何在Android中实现简单的串口通信,并提供相应的代码示例和关系图。
## 什么是串口调试工具?
串口调试工具是一种用于监控和管理串口通信的软件工具。常见
这周大部分时间主要用来调试GTM900B这个模块了,其实说白了,就是对于串口的操作,再换句话说就是对于文件的读写。首先串口配置的问题这次采用了标准模式(行缓冲),就是在发送命令后加上一个‘回车’才从串口中发出去,其实在发送‘回车’之前,我们的数据是存放在串口缓冲区中的,只有在遇到回车时,才将缓冲区中的数据发出。这里就牵扯到一个回车(carriagereturn ’\r’,0X0D)跟换行(line